How Common Is The Last Name Mernov?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 1,882,912th most prevalent last name on a worldwide basis, held by around 1 in 75,129,339 people. This last name is mostly found in Europe, where 96 percent of Mernov reside; 84 percent reside in Eastern Europe and 84 percent reside in East Slavic Europe.
The surname is most commonly used in Russia, where it is held by 72 people, or 1 in 2,001,709. In Russia Mernov is primarily found in: Stavropol Krai, where 49 percent are found, Moscow, where 18 percent are found and Astrakhan Oblast, where 7 percent are found. Besides Russia it exists in 6 countries. It is also found in Denmark, where 11 percent are found and Ukraine, where 10 percent are found.
